Position Summary

The Financial Analyst reports to the Vice President of Capital Markets and supports the structuring and execution of HDC’s tax-exempt and taxable multifamily affordable housing bond financings. Working closely with internal departments and external partners, the analyst will assist with bond issuance activities, debt portfolio management, bond call and refunding analyses, cash flow analyses, and the evaluation of new debt structures.

Job Responsibilities

  • Structure bond offerings and execute bond pricings and closings, including preparing investor roadshows, rating agency presentations, and other investor marketing materials
  • Review and update bond and mortgage portfolio information, including summaries by bond interest rate mode, interest rate hedge details, mortgage loan lien priority and credit enhancement, and counterparty exposure
  • Create and maintain portfolio models to support bond issuance, identify and evaluate financing opportunities and alternatives, and conduct debt capacity and feasibility analyses
  • Perform cash flow analyses to evaluate debt financing alternatives
  • Create and maintain portfolio databases for ongoing monitoring and reporting requirements
  • Leverage HDC software engineering team to develop customized management reports and bond and mortgage loan tracking information
  • Identify key requirements (systems, reports, processes, and interfaces) to sustain existing data structures and to update and maintain database information
